The Spartan Echo is Norfolk State University's campus newspaper and is administrated through NSU's Office of Student Affairs. It's published during the academic year by a staff of student volunteers who are regularly advised by a Mass Communications and Journalism Department faculty member.

Every NSU student has the opportunity to gain valuable print journalism experience through volunteer associations with the paper as a reporter, editor, photographer, or graphic artist. In addition, some individual courses in Mass Communications and Journalism require students to produce original material for the Spartan Echo as part of their course work.

Thus, a student who begins working with the Spartan Echo as a freshman volunteer, and continues working with the Spartan Echo in various capacities, graduates with at least four years of experience in print journalism. That, along with a baccalaureate degree from NSU Mass Communications and Journalism, has helped many graduates land that important first job in the highly competitive print journalism industry.
